Professor Jenson received an MFA in Studio Art from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ill and a BFA in Drawing and Painting from the University of Minnesota at Duluth. Jensen’s work explores modes of drawing and probes issues regarding utility and function, biology and narrative. She teaches drawing at the foundation, intermediate and advanced levels and mentors senior projects. Recent exhibitions include “Alive! Commodity, Zombie, Avatar, Fetish” at the School of the Art Institute of Chicago, IL; Shift and Collide: Drawings From Near and Far at Riverworks Gallery in Greenville, SC; and Circus at Gallery Project in Ann Arbor, MI. Ms. Jensen is a fellow of several residency programs, including La Napoule Foundation in France; the Millay Colony in Austerlitz, NY; and Willapa Bay AiR in Oysterville, WA.
